Transaction 4389ca984020a49143d1e411c1e9b0de4f79b6f8e342ab35f3c2c9030cb63458

1 Input
2 Outputs
  • 4389ca984020a49143d1e411c1e9b0de4f79b6f8e342ab35f3c2c9030cb63458:0
  • value  20000000
    address  3EW8dF4fngRmAeunY5fG3iUACqyBE6MuGZ
  • 4389ca984020a49143d1e411c1e9b0de4f79b6f8e342ab35f3c2c9030cb63458:1
  • value  71662874
    address  18b9jBKspbAWktLHrGr9K6nfkQnrSTWTxR